Description: Hours: Six hours activity per week
Prerequisites: ART 105 or ART 106 or ART107 or COMP 105 or consent of instructor
An introduction to techniques and concepts involved in the production of interactive multimedia. Projects explore basic interactive technologies utilized in the creation of digital graphics, websites and computer game designs.
Units: 3.00
Grading: Letter Grade
